DXGKARG_FLIPOVERLAY struttura (d3dkmddi.h)

La struttura DXGKARG_FLIPOVERLAY descrive una nuova allocazione da visualizzare per la sovrapposizione.

Sintassi

typedef struct _DXGKARG_FLIPOVERLAY {
  [in] HANDLE           hSource;
  [in] PHYSICAL_ADDRESS SrcPhysicalAddress;
  [in] UINT             SrcSegmentId;
  [in] VOID             *pPrivateDriverData;
  [in] UINT             PrivateDriverDataSize;
} DXGKARG_FLIPOVERLAY;

Members

[in] hSource

Handle per l'allocazione di origine da visualizzare.

[in] SrcPhysicalAddress

Indirizzo fisico, all'interno del segmento specificato da SrcSegmentId, dell'allocazione da visualizzare .

[in] SrcSegmentId

Identificatore di un segmento in cui l'allocazione è attualmente in pagina.

[in] pPrivateDriverData

Puntatore a un blocco di dati privati passati dal driver di visualizzazione in modalità utente al driver miniport visualizzato visualizzato.

[in] PrivateDriverDataSize

Dimensioni, in byte, del blocco di dati privati a cui pPrivateDriverData punta.

Requisiti

Requisito Valore
Client minimo supportato Windows Vista
Intestazione d3dkmddi.h (include D3dkmddi.h)

Vedi anche

DxgkDdiFlipOverlay